The community non-profit organization that I work with would like to begin sending an automated email to new contacts when they sign up for any of our mailing lists. It seems drip campaigns are the favorable way to do so because, unlike Welcome Emails, drip campaigns can be triggered when contacts are manually added to a list. I want to make sure that if a contact joins multiple mailing lists for our organization, they will not be sent multiple welcoming emails. Will drip campaigns automatically correct for this? Or is there a setting I can trigger to ensure multiple of the same email are not sent to the same address?
Hello @ReneeB548 ,
If the singular welcome path is set to trigger from multiple lists, then it will only trigger once for a contact added to any of those selected lists.
If you choose to have individual "welcome" automation paths for individual lists, then contacts added to those standalone lists will trigger their corresponding standalone automations.
